Tony McGinn
Chief Executive Officer and Managing Director - mcm entertainment group ltd.

Tony McGinn founded mcm entertainment in 1983 and has been its Chief Executive Officer since that time. In his 24 years as principal, Tony has built up considerable experience in radio, television and new digital media production and syndication, event management, sponsorship, advertising and marketing, and building and operating multi platform media businesses. He has approximately 20 years international experience and industry knowledge and contacts within the entertainment, production, marketing and media industries. In the last few years, Tony has led the Company's expansion into the new digital media area, with a particular focus on developing and expanding the Company's advertiser funded content onto the online and mobile platforms.

 

Greg Smith
Non-Executive Director

The course of Greg's career spans every facet of radio business management, culminating in his appointment to the position of Group Program Director of the Austereo Group. Under his direction, the Austereo Group achieved the unique position of having every single FM station in the Austereo Group at the number one position for the March 1992 radio survey. In 1995, Greg established a successful radio & research consulting business, servicing radio stations around the world and designing research projects for two of Australia's free to air commercial television networks. In 2007, he was inducted into the Commercial Radio Hall of Fame.

 

Vincent Donato
Non-Executive Director

Vincent Donato began his career in music and entertainment at Mushroom Records as an Accountant, a position that he held for 6 years. He subsequently joined Network Ten as Financial Controller - Production and later worked on multimedia projects with Film Victoria and the Multimedia 21 Fund. He later joined Crawford Productions as Financial Controller before joining Shock Records as Group Financial Controller, a position he held for 5 years before becoming Group Finance Director. He then formed Liberator Music. He holds a Bachelor of Economics (Accounting) from Latrobe University and is a Fellow of CPA Australia. He was appointed a Non-Executive Director of the Company in May 2006.

 

Julien Playoust
Non-Executive Director

Julien Playoust is Managing Director of AEH Group, a Sydney-based private investment company. His professional career includes Andersen Consulting and Accenture and his experience includes capital structuring, mergers and acquisitions, strategy, change, technology and supply-chain programs within consumer discretionary, energy, resource, property and financial services sectors. Current external appointments include Director of Tattersalls Limited and Director of Australian Renewable Fuels Limited, both ASX-listed companies, and he is chairman of the REM committees for both companies. He is a Director of private equity company MGB Equity Growth Pty Limited, a Trustee of the Art Gallery NSW Foundation and on the Advisory Board of The Nature Conservancy. He is a director of the Playoust Family Foundation. He is a member of the Australian Institute of Company Directors, Australian Institute of Management, Royal Australian Institute of Architects and The Executive Connection. He holds a Masters of Business Administration from AGSM, Bachelor of Architecture First Class Honours and Bachelor of Science from Sydney University and a Company Director Course Diploma from the AICD.

 

Santiago Burridge
Non-Executive Director

Santi is a practicing partner in a boutique financial services firm, Vivid Financial and has worked within the business for 10 years. His current external appointments are as a Director of Premier Superannuation Services Pty Ltd, a leading provider of Self Managed Superannuation fund services, Implemented Portfolios Pty Ltd a fledgling provider of Managed Account Services and Fund Management, and Lessinghams Financial Service Pty Ltd which is a boutique Financial Planning Firm. He holds a Bachelor of Commerce majoring in Economics and Finance from Griffith University and Diploma in Financial Planning from Deakin University. He is a member of the Australian Institute of Company Directors.
